題目描述
這是乙個風和日麗的日子,桐人和詩乃在約會。他們所在的城市共有n個街區,和m條道路,每條道路連線兩個不同的街區,並且通過一條道路需要花費一些時間。他們現在處於n號街區,正在享受幸福時光的桐人完全忘記了他的手機被亞絲娜安裝了監控裝置的事情,此時亞絲娜已經得知了桐人的位置以及他正在和乙個妹子約會的事實,十分憤怒,於是從她所在的1號街區火速趕往n號街區。現在這個城市中有一條道路正在維修,不能通行,不過不論是哪條道路處於維修中,均存在一條路徑可以從1號街區前往n號街區,而且亞絲娜一定會選取最短路前往n號街區。現在你很好奇,桐人的美好時光最多還能持續多久,即亞絲娜最多要花費多長的時間才能到達n號街區。
輸入第1行:兩個正整數n,m,n表示街區個數,m表示道路數。
第2到m+1行 每行三個整數 u,v,w 表示存在一條連線u和v的道路,通過這條道路花費的時間為w
資料保證沒有重邊和自環
輸出乙個整數,表示最多花費的時間。
輸入樣例
5 71 2 8
1 4 10
2 3 9
2 4 10
2 5 1
3 4 7
3 5 10
輸出樣例
27說明
【資料規模】
30% n<=5, m<=10
60% n<=1000,m<=10000,w=1
100% n<=1000, m<=n*(n-1)/2,1<=w<=1000..
...分析
如果存在一條路徑會影響1至n的最短路,那麼這段路徑一定存在於最短路上 ,所以找一條最短路,並列舉去掉的路徑,找最短路中的最長路。..
...程式:
#include#include#include#includeusing namespace std;
int ls[2000001],zd[1001],cnt=0;
struct edge
e[2000001];
void add(int x,int y,int w)
int spfa(int s,int t,int flag)
}printf("%d",ans);
return 0;
}
桐桐的雷達
有一堆數字,並給出乙個範圍,判斷不在範圍內的數字是否多過10 若不多過,那輸出範圍內數字的平均值 桐桐在去廣州的路上,對高速公路上的測速雷達產生了興趣,於是開始研究有關知識,發現在設計測速雷達時有這樣乙個計算問題 乙個測速雷達都有乙個最高限速和乙個最低限速。如果探測到的資料超過最高限速或低於最低限速...
桐桐的雷達 模擬
description 乙個測速雷達都有乙個最高限速和乙個最低限速。如果探測到的資料超過最高限速或低於最低限速,都認為駕駛員是違規的。為了檢測探測器是否正常工作,雷達自身要週期性的分析一下最近的資料。假設多數駕駛員遵守交通規則,因此如果有超過10 的資料是違規的,則認為探測器可能出了問題。現在根據給...
搜尋 桐桐的數學遊戲
第二天叫醒我的不是鬧鐘,是夢想!題目描述 相信大家都聽過經典的 八皇后 問題吧?這個遊戲要求在 個8 8的棋盤上放置8個皇后,使8個皇后互相不攻擊 攻擊的含義是有兩個皇后在同一行或同一列或同一對角線上 桐桐對這個遊戲很感興趣,也很快解決了這個問題。可是,她想為自己增加一點難度,於是她想求出n皇后的解...